An appeal having been taken to this Court from the order of the Supreme Court, New York County, entered on or about August 11, 2016, and said appeal having been perfected, And Common Cause New York having moved for leave to file an amicus brief and for leave to appear amicus curiae in connection with the aforesaid appeal,Now, upon reading and filing the papers with respect to the motion, and due deliberation having been had thereon, It is ordered that the motion is granted, movant is permitted to appear amicus curiae, and is directed to file 9 copies of said amicus curiae brief within seven days of this order.ENTERED: November 2, 2017
